I started out competition shooting in pistol silhouette, iron sights out to 200 meters. It was later that I tried Conventional (Bullseye, now Precision) and was mid pack in performance right at the start. I improved and got a chance to shoot some international; free pistol, standard, air, and center fire. Bullseye was tough and international was harder but if you give it an honest effort, it makes you a lot better shooter.
I have shot some PPC and did well because Bullseye, Silhouette, and International teach good fundamentals. I did have people who never did it say in Free pistol that a minute per shot is too long but I have yet to see any of the same people put on a clinic to show me how it is done.
